Output 8760c8957800d5ad565f76c5f6c8da7bc54ddf76967dbc82c166afa1c1324cb4:40

value
416680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f4cbe73e1e12f813efa84c5c67272d48b437125 OP_EQUAL
address
38vKExk2Hg4xGC4poausr3WuhbUmseN5Uc
transaction
8760c8957800d5ad565f76c5f6c8da7bc54ddf76967dbc82c166afa1c1324cb4
confirmations
220614
spent
true